LISLE, N.Y. – Robert “PC” Harold Call Sr., 77, of Lisle, passed away peacefully Feb. 24, 2005, at his home after a short illness. He was predeceased by his parents, one brother, one sister, and one grandson. He is survived by his loving wife of nearly 53 years, Ruth (Cron) Call of Lisle; their children, B.J. and Julie Call, David and Moira Call, Ope and Rosemary Call, SallyAnn and Bill Bruce, Cindy-Kay and Tom Clark Sr.; 15 grandchildren, 12 great-grand-children, four brothers, one sisters, several in-laws, nieces, and nephews, a special niece, Judy Saddlemire. Bob enjoyed working as a water well driller for more than 50 years. He was also a veteran of World War II. He enjoyed traveling and spending time with family and friends.
